The Offer values , the entire issued and to be issued share capital of Xchanging at approximately £412 million, and represents a premium of approximately:
1-44 per cent. to the Closing Price of 111 pence per Xchanging Share on 2 October 2015, being the last Business Day prior to the commencement of the Offer Period;
2-52 per cent. to the average Closing Price of 105 pence per Xchanging Share for the three months ended on 2 October 2015, being the last Business Day prior to the commencement of the Offer Period; and
3-64 per cent. to the average Closing Price of 98 pence per Xchanging Share for the month ended on 2 October 2015, being the last Business Day prior to the commencement of the Offer Period.
The acquisition of Xchanging by Capita is consistent with Capita`s stated strategy of acquiring businesses that build capability in existing operations, allow Capita to enter new attractive industry segments and enhance its future organic growth potential.
4-The Capita Board believes that the acquisition would:
5-position Capita as one of the leading providers of technology-enabled business process services ("BPS") in the attractive international insurance and asset administration industries;
6- provide a stronger platform for Xchanging to accelerate sales growth and to develop its software, technology and procurement solutions under Capita`s stewardship; and
7- enable Capita to secure at least £35 million in cost synergy benefits driven by head office, shared services and IT efficiencies in FY2017, at a cost of around £20 million in the first 12 months after acquisition.
8- The Offer is expected to be immediately earnings accretive for Capita and to deliver returns significantly in excess of Capita`s cost of capital.
Capita is a leading UK provider of technology-enabled customer and business process services ("BPS") and integrated professional support services. With 68,000 people at over 400 sites, including 80 business centres across the UK, Europe, India and South Africa, Capita uses its expertise, infrastructure and scale benefits to transform its clients` services, driving down costs and adding value. Capita is quoted on the London Stock Exchange (CPI.L), and is a constituent of the FTSE 100 with 2014 revenue of £4.4 billion.
9- Xchanging is a business technology and services provider. Xchanging uses innovation, technology and customer and market insight to provide differentiated solutions to its customers

ICICI Securities Limited has submitted to the Exchange a copy of Open offer ("Offer") for acquisition of up to 27,850,929 fully paid-up equity shares of face value of INR 10 (Indian Rupees ten) each ("Equity Shares"), representing 25% (twenty five percent) of the fully diluted voting equity share capital of Xchanging Solutions Limited ("Target Company") by Capita plc ("Acquirer") along with Ventura (India) Private Limited, in its capacity as the person acting in concert with the Acquirer ("PAC"), from the Public Shareholders of the Target Company. Save and except for the PAC, no other person is acting in concert with the Acquirer for the purpose of this Offer.
